Step 3: Hookups (continued) Hookup 3 Pages 16 to 18 Antenna hookup Make the following connections if you're using an antenna (if you don't have cable TV). VHF C UHF If you cannot connect your antenna cable to the VCR directly If your antenna cable is a flat cable (300-ohm twin lead cable), attach an external antenna connector (not supplied) so that you can connect the cable to the VHF/UHF IN connector. If you have separate cables for VHF and UHF antennas, you should use a U/V band mixer (not supplied). For details, see page 79. 16 Getting Started
